Design meets safety and efficiency

Evidence Based Design

168_prrmc_21stThe design of the new hospital will be driven by the desire to create a design using proven methods to positively impact patient safety, clinical outcomes, environment and patient, physician and employee satisfaction.

  • Research shows that natural lighting in a patient's room reduces the need for pain medication by 22 percent.
  • Studies show that private patient rooms, which are acuity adaptable, reduce medication errors by 67 percent.
  • Reducing noise in a patient's room with sound absorbing ceilings, floors and walls improves sleep by 49 percent.

"Lean" Efficiency

We improved efficiency by designing the facility to reduce the number of steps an employee takes in a shift
 

Save a foot, gain a mile - 30 percent of a nurse's shift is spent walking. Presbyterian Rio Rancho Hospital's medical/surgical floor design will result in an annual reduction for a nurses' walking distance equal to the distance from Rio Rancho to Gallup, New Mexico
